Apollo.io has an employee rating of 3.7 out of 5 stars, based on 266 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have a good working experience there. The Apollo.io employ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Information Technology industry (3.9 stars).

If you value your mental health don't join this company

Anonymous employee
Recommend
CEO approval
Business Outlook

Pros

- Remote work. - Brilliant, smart and great peers. - Product really works well and is a game changer for customers. - Apollo is great hiring top talent.

Cons

Work-life balance is non existent at Apollo. The workload is consistently overwhelming, and requires employees to sacrifice personal time and health to keep up with daily tasks and meet performance expectations. Leadership expects responsiveness even during PTO, and the “fast-paced, growth environment” often feels more like unmanaged chaos. Arbitrary decisions from leadership go unquestioned, creating a toxic culture where employees have little choice but to accept or leave - Unfoutunately all of the above has been normalized by long term employees. 1on1 Customer facing roles are severely under-resourced, there are not enough people to handle training, claims, or customers/prospects questions, which leaves customers waiting until frustration builds. By the time they reach a CSM or AE, interactions can be hostile and sometimes rude, something I've never seen in a Saas Company until Apollo. I've never worked in a Call Center but some colleagues said that's the intensity of a call center, which is atypical for a SaaS environment. Roles are poorly structured, with one person covering responsibilities that in other companies are assigned to 3 individual roles. compensation especially for non U.S. employees is far below market standards despite the company’s profitability. While the product is strong, colleagues are talented and the Apollo Logo can look great in a CV, the tradeoff is a culture that comes at the expense of employee health and well-being. For these reasons, I would not recommend this company to people I care about.
